Undergraduate Social Sciences Degrees at Duke University

The following degree levels are offered in social sciences at Duke University,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Bachelor’s 340
Master’s 159
Doctoral 30
Graduate Certificate 11

Social Sciences Majors at Duke University

This social sciences area of study at Duke University includes the following specific majors. Follow a link for the major’s detailed rankings and outcomes:

Major Annual Graduates
Economics 276
Political Science and Government 141
International Relations and National Security Studies 66
Sociology 38
Anthropology 19

Salary of Social Sciences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$113,144 Bachelor's Median Salary

Social Sciences students who finish a bachelor’s at Duke University go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$113,144 a year. This is below $115,482, the median for all majors at Duke University.

Salary for Social Sciences majors with a bachelor's degree at Duke University

Student Debt of Social Sciences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$13,726 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at Duke University, social sciences students borrow a median amount of $13,726 in student loans. This is higher than $13,191, the typical median for all majors at Duke University.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 57% of social sciences bachelor’s degrees went to men and 43% went to women.

Duke University gender breakdown of Social Sciences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of social sciences bachelor’s degree graduates at Duke University are White. About 47%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Duke University with a bachelor’s in social sciences.

Ethnic diversity of Social Sciences majors at Duke University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 64
Black or African American 28
Hispanic or Latino 33
White 160
Non-Resident Aliens 31
Other Races 24
